Here's the extended circle marks, all are 6" from the center of the middle dot.
Cut out the circle. It's easiest to trace around the circle with a sharp knife.
To mark the sheet for six shroud lines -
Fold the circle in half.
Fold the outsides in into even thirds. Lightly mark the folds with a Sharpie.
I cut three 26" lengths of #10 cotton embroidery thread.
Cutting 26" long lines allows 1" on either side for the loop and knots.
Here's the finished chute, ready to be tied onto the shock cord.
